This demo shows our ongoing work on the co-simulation of co-operative Unmanned Aerial Vehicles (UAVs). The work is based on the INTO-CPS co-simulation engine, which adopts the widely accepted Functional Mockup Interface (FMI) standard for co-simulation, and the PVSioweb prototyping tool, that extends a system simulator based on the PVS logic language with a web-based graphical interface. Simple scenarios of Quadcopters with assigned different tasks, such as rendez-vous and space coverage, are shown. We assumed a linearized dynamic model for Quadcopters formalized in OpenModelica, and a linearized set of equations for the flight control module written in C language. The co-ordination algorithm is modeled in PVS, while PVSio-web is used for graphical rendering of the co-simulation.

Palmieri, M., Bernardeschi, C., Domenici, A., Fagiolini, A. (2018). Demo: Co-simulation of UAVs with INTO-CPS and PVSio-web. In Software Technologies: Applications and Foundations: STAF 2018 Collocated Workshops (pp. 52-57). Heidelberg : Springer Verlag [10.1007/978-3-030-04771-9_5].

Demo: Co-simulation of UAVs with INTO-CPS and PVSio-web

Fagiolini, Adriano
2018-01-01

Abstract

This demo shows our ongoing work on the co-simulation of co-operative Unmanned Aerial Vehicles (UAVs). The work is based on the INTO-CPS co-simulation engine, which adopts the widely accepted Functional Mockup Interface (FMI) standard for co-simulation, and the PVSioweb prototyping tool, that extends a system simulator based on the PVS logic language with a web-based graphical interface. Simple scenarios of Quadcopters with assigned different tasks, such as rendez-vous and space coverage, are shown. We assumed a linearized dynamic model for Quadcopters formalized in OpenModelica, and a linearized set of equations for the flight control module written in C language. The co-ordination algorithm is modeled in PVS, while PVSio-web is used for graphical rendering of the co-simulation.
2018
9783030047702
Palmieri, M., Bernardeschi, C., Domenici, A., Fagiolini, A. (2018). Demo: Co-simulation of UAVs with INTO-CPS and PVSio-web. In Software Technologies: Applications and Foundations: STAF 2018 Collocated Workshops (pp. 52-57). Heidelberg : Springer Verlag [10.1007/978-3-030-04771-9_5].
File in questo prodotto:
File Dimensione Formato  
Demo_Co_simulation.pdf

Solo gestori archvio

Tipologia: Versione Editoriale
Dimensione 388.04 kB
Formato Adobe PDF
388.04 kB Adobe PDF   Visualizza/Apri   Richiedi una copia

I documenti in IRIS s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.

Utilizza questo identificativo per citare o creare un link a questo documento: https://hdl.handle.net/10447/357673
Citazioni
  • ???jsp.display-item.citation.pmc??? ND
  • Scopus 1
  • ???jsp.display-item.citation.isi??? 0
social impact